What is Biosense?
Biosense operates at the intersection of digital health and metabolic science, providing a clinically validated breath ketone monitor that delivers real-time biofeedback. By utilizing deep lung air sampling, the device offers a sophisticated, non-invasive alternative to traditional blood-based ketone testing, effectively removing the friction associated with finger-prick diagnostics. The company serves a growing demographic of health-conscious individuals and metabolic experts who prioritize precision in tracking fat-burning processes and personalized wellness goals. Through its focus on user-centric design and scientific rigor, Biosense has established a unique market position as a leader in accessible metabolic monitoring, catering to the increasing demand for data-driven health optimization tools.
How much funding has Biosense raised?
Biosense has raised a total of $2.2M across 1 funding round:
Angel/Seed
$2.2M
Angel/Seed (2020): $2.2M with participation from iSelect Funds
